Tockwith is a popular semi-rural North Yorkshire village with excellent amenities including a village shop, post office, hairdressers, doctor’s surgery, two pubs and a highly regarded nursery and primary school. The market town of Wetherby is only some 10 minutes’ drive with a wide range of amenities and also bypassed by the A1 for travel further afield. Cattle train station is approx. 2 miles away.
